Output 7dd3086f99c7f5a226204e878e2103968fc020b33ca8f8aba883c3e657a4b17b:0

value
43330000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0efce86ee9a3bd8636a4aac9e4c23ba0a237cc6a OP_EQUALVERIFY OP_CHECKSIG
address
12NFS3BF36qw89ABxW5qNyEDBwCytmHJm2
transaction
7dd3086f99c7f5a226204e878e2103968fc020b33ca8f8aba883c3e657a4b17b
spent
true